没有TCP/IP知识的新手警报...我正在尝试设置一个生产测试台,通过在XP PC上安装6个NIC卡来测试嵌入式6路以太网交换机。为了证明这一点,我从两个NIC开始,这两个NIC都在同一子网上,手动IP地址172.16.0.1 / 172.16.0.2。路由表(route print)显示(我相信)两个环回条目:
=====================================================
172.16.0.0 255.255.255.0 172.16.0.1 172.16.0.1
172.16.0.0 255.255.255.0 172.16.0.2 172.16.0.2
172.16.0.1 255.255.255.255 127.0.0.1 127.0.0.1
172.16.0.2 255.255.255.255 127.0.0.1 127.0.0.1
172.16.255.255 255.255.255.255 172.16.0.1 172.16.0.1
172.16.255.255 255.255.255.255 172.16.0.2 172.16.0.2
=====================================================我想删除环回条目,并将其替换为“始终外部”路由条目。即,如果您ping 172.16.0.1数据包使用适配器172.16.0.2,并由交换机路由回172.16.0.1,如果您ping 172.16.0.2数据包离开172.16.0.1,并由交换机路由回172.16.0.2,从而对电缆、交换机IC、磁体等进行基本的连通性测试。
命令:route add 172.16.0.1 mask 255.255.255.255 172.16.0.2 (在我看来是唯一指定使用172.16.0.2向目的地172.16.0.1发送数据包)失败,并显示“路由添加失败:路由参数不正确”。
While:route add 172.16.0.2 mask 255.255.255.255 172.16.0.1是可以接受的,但是我不能使用ping 172.16.0.2
我确实在你以前的帖子中找到了一些很好的解释,解释了表格中每一行的含义,但我显然不太理解发生了什么。我有点担心自动生成的路由表已经指定了两个适配器作为网关,但我了解的还不够多,无法理解其中的含义。
最终,有了6个NIC,我希望能够制作一个表,使我能够测试交换机上的每个端口。
非常感谢David
发布于 2013-08-16 00:44:36
您可以使用ping来完成此操作。首先将NIC设置为具有静态IP地址。我将向您提供一个具有两个NIC的示例。NIC1设置为192.168.0.2,NIC2为192.168.0.1。然后运行命令:
-t 192.168.0.2 -s 192.168.0.1 ping
我想您会发现,如果您拔下外部环回电缆,测试将失败,如果您重新插入它,它将通过。有关ping的更多帮助,请键入ping -?
您可能必须禁用Windows防火墙才能让ping通信通过。
https://stackoverflow.com/questions/15228568
复制相似问题